在Java编程中,我们经常需要使用循环来打印表格,这可以通过多种方式实现,具体取决于我们想要打印的表格的样式和复杂性,下面,我们将介绍一种简单的方法,使用Java的for循环来打印一个基本的二维表格。
基本概念
在Java中,我们可以使用嵌套的for循环来打印表格,外层循环控制行数,内层循环控制列数,这样,我们就可以通过控制循环的次数来决定表格的大小。
代码示例
下面是一个简单的Java代码示例,使用for循环打印一个3x3的表格:
public class PrintTable { public static void main(String[] args) { // 定义表格的行数和列数 int rows = 3; int cols = 3; // 使用嵌套的for循环打印表格 for (int i = 1; i <= rows; i++) { // 外层循环控制行 for (int j = 1; j <= cols; j++) { // 内层循环控制列 // 打印表格的每个单元格,这里我们简单地打印数字和空格作为示例 System.out.print("(" + i + "," + j + ") "); } // 每打印完一行后换行 System.out.println(); } } }
代码解释
这段代码首先定义了表格的行数和列数,使用两个嵌套的for循环来遍历每一行和每一列,在每次循环中,我们都打印出当前单元格的编号(这里用行号和列号表示),并在每行的末尾换行,这样,我们就得到了一个简单的3x3表格。
扩展应用
这只是一个非常基础的示例,在实际应用中,你可能需要打印更复杂的表格,比如带有标题、边框或者不同内容的表格,这时,你可以根据需要修改代码,比如添加额外的逻辑来处理标题和边框的打印,或者使用更复杂的格式化方法来控制每个单元格的显示内容。
在Java中,使用循环来打印表格是一种常见的编程任务,通过嵌套的for循环,我们可以轻松地控制表格的行数和列数,并打印出我们需要的内容,无论是基础的二维表格还是更复杂的表格,都可以通过类似的逻辑来实现,希望这篇文章能帮助你更好地理解如何使用Java的循环来打印表格。
《java如何用循环打印表格》 这篇文章提供了更多关于Java循环打印表格的详细信息和示例代码,值得一读。
本文"Java编程语言中如何使用循环打印表格"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。